Advice for young and aspiring content creators and influencers
For young and emerging content creators and influencers, she stated, “Make sure the hobby you base your content on is something you’re truly passionate about—and remember, your work ethic matters just as much.”
“It should be strong enough to carry you through periods when your engagement plateaus or even declines,” she noted.
“At the end of the day, the No. 1 person you should be creating for is yourself. Have confidence in your work and enjoy the process of creating it,” she added.
